This course provides: 

Chapter 1: Basic concepts of fluid mechanics including terminologies, physical values, fluid properties and measurement. 

Chapter 2: Fundamentals of fluid statics which covers Pascal’s law, Euler’s equation of fluid statics, measurement of pressure and hydrostatic forces on surfaces.

Chapter 3:  Concepts of Buoyancy, Flotation and Stability.

Chapter 4: Fundamentals of fluid dynamics including continuity equation, basic laws of fluid dynamics – conservation of mass, conservation of linear momentum, conservation of energy, and application of Bernoulli’s equation.
